diff --git a/app/src/main/java/io/github/sspanak/tt9/ime/modes/predictions/LocaleWordsSorter.java b/app/src/main/java/io/github/sspanak/tt9/ime/modes/predictions/LocaleWordsSorter.java index 5c54ef1c..a6f94701 100644 --- a/app/src/main/java/io/github/sspanak/tt9/ime/modes/predictions/LocaleWordsSorter.java +++ b/app/src/main/java/io/github/sspanak/tt9/ime/modes/predictions/LocaleWordsSorter.java @@ -38,7 +38,7 @@ class LocaleWordsSorter { ArrayList sort(ArrayList words) { - if (sortingPattern == null || words == null) { + if (sortingPattern == null || words == null || words.isEmpty()) { return words; } diff --git a/app/src/main/java/io/github/sspanak/tt9/languages/NaturalLanguage.java b/app/src/main/java/io/github/sspanak/tt9/languages/NaturalLanguage.java index a83597d3..7a888f3e 100644 --- a/app/src/main/java/io/github/sspanak/tt9/languages/NaturalLanguage.java +++ b/app/src/main/java/io/github/sspanak/tt9/languages/NaturalLanguage.java @@ -195,6 +195,7 @@ public class NaturalLanguage extends Language implements Comparable